About Ordinox
Ordinox provides a cross-chain swapping infrastructure that facilitates the transfer of liquidity from Ethereum Virtual Machine (EVM) decentralized finance (DeFi) ecosystems to Ordinal Inscription-based tokens. This technology addresses the fragmentation of liquidity across different blockchain networks, enabling seamless token swaps and enhancing market accessibility.
